#966f95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#966f95 is composed of 58.8% red, 43.5%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26% magenta, 0.7%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 301.5 degrees, a saturation of 15.7% and a lightness of 51.2%. #966f95 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deff with #2d002b.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

#966f95 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#966f95 has RGB values of R:150, G:111,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.01,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9858965.
